Transaction 5216253b6b41a512008b0a4160e788f72d1b9379066b1932a1364eca209b110d

1 Input
2 Outputs
  • 5216253b6b41a512008b0a4160e788f72d1b9379066b1932a1364eca209b110d:0
  • value  29012234
    address  3LtEuzUxvJbP4E8jVjRF1Zs1BCohPBZ8Jx
  • 5216253b6b41a512008b0a4160e788f72d1b9379066b1932a1364eca209b110d:1
  • value  100000000
    address  1NsX7fKkRfrzzB5SPRvCVj8hhk9rMxMRgW